Entwickler-Ecke

Windows API - Eventlog auslesen bei Grösse < 4 MB ...


uranop - Mo 13.07.09 08:54
Titel: Eventlog auslesen bei Grösse < 4 MB ...
Servus,

Ich habe da mal ein Anliegen ...
In meinem Prog greife ich remote auf das Eventlog eines entfernten Rechners zu.
Soweit sogut alles kein Thema.
Aber , wenn der Log zu gross wird, und ich hatte schon Clients mit grösser 250MB
dann wird das auslesen zur Qual.

Besteht irgendwie die Möglichkeit die Grösse des Logs im Vorfeld zu checken und den
Anwender informieren das bei Grösse > 4MB halt nicht alles ausgelesen wird ?


Gruß


Moderiert von user profile iconNarses: Topic aus Delphi Language (Object-Pascal) / CLX verschoben am Mo 13.07.2009 um 18:24


BenBE - Mo 13.07.09 09:13

Da der Eventlog AFAIK eine Datenbank-Bindung erlaubt, sollte es auch möglich sein, dessen Zeilenanzahl abzufragen. Daraus sollte man die Größe abschätzen können.